The Meaning Behind the Name
At its core, "Satyam" means "truth." Derived from Sanskrit, one of the world's oldest languages, it encapsulates not only the concept of truth but also the essence of reality and authenticity. The roots "Satya" mean truth, and the suffix "-am" elevates it to denote the absolute truth. This isn't just a name; it's a philosophy, a virtue, and a guiding principle embedded in Indian culture and spiritual thought.
Origin and Cultural Roots
Originating from the ancient Indian subcontinent, "Satyam" has been a revered term in Hinduism, Jainism, and Buddhism. The famous phrase "Satyam Eva Jayate" meaning "Truth Alone Triumphs," is the national motto of India and underscores how integral this concept is to the nation's identity. Nicknames and Variations
One of the joys of names like Satyam is the variety of affectionate nicknames it inspires: Satya, Sattu, Sati, Sat, and many more. Variations in spelling, such as Sathyam or Satyan, reflect regional pronunciations and personal preferences but retain the name's essence.
Fun Facts and Trivia
Did you know that the phrase "Satyam Eva Jayate" comes from the ancient Mundaka Upanishad, a revered Hindu scripture? Also, "Satyam" is not just a name but a concept that has influenced Indian art, philosophy, and governance. The global recognition of the name has grown, partly due to the global IT company once named Satyam Computer Services.
